Trips and excursions
Day Trips
Day trips are organised in collaboration with local community institutions such as the Police service, Fire Service, libraries, conservation areas and local Government. Pupils visit places of educational and cultural interest such as museums, theatre and concert performances.
Residential activities
The School organises several residential activities each year such as adventure weekends ski, sailing, climbing and canoeing as well as Saturday activities to nearby places of interest.
Trip to the United Kingdom
Primary 6 pupils take part in an annual trip to the United Kingdom. Accompanied and supervised by School staff the pupils spend an action packed week visiting places of historical, cultural and educational interest directly related to the school curriculum. The trip, more importantly, serves as a first hand experience of English speaking culture.
Trips to France and Germany
Secondary students take part in trips to France and Germany after between 2–4 years study of the relevant language.
